What You Need to Know about Different Types of Change-Over Valves

Change-over valves are very imperative in safety-intensive operations and high-pressure systems. They allow switching between two safety valves, or pressure relief devices or pressure relief instrumentation without stopping the system. What is a Change-Over Valve?


Change-Over Valve is a two-switching valve system to join two safety valves, in parallel. As and when one of the valves is due to carry out maintenance, or checkup; the flow may be switched to the stand-by valve without halting the whole system. This operation is critical to the industries which focus on constant operation and safety maintenance.

Types of Change-Over Valves

The knowledge of various kinds of change-over valves will assist you to choose the proper configuration in your particular application.

1. Manual Change-Over valves

These are worked by hand by the plant attendants by turning a lever or wheel. They are cheap to implement and are not very difficult to set up, but they cannot run in absence of physical access and trained people.

Best For:

  • Planned systems of maintenance Avoidable problems will be eliminated.
  • Lower-risk environments

2. Automatic change-Over Valves

Automatic valves make the change between safety valves automatically and without the need to intervene manually, equipped as they are with actuators and control systems. This kind of Change-Over Valve suits such cases in critical systems where the prompt response is needed.

Best For:

  • Remote or high-risk-locations
  • Industries that need automation and real time monitoring

3. Three Way Change-Over Valves

Such valves are configured to have three inlets and outlets, two being inlet and outlets, and one being a shared inlet and outlet, making a saving on the flow disturbance and a smoother changeover.

Best For:

  • High-flow systems
  • Systems that require equal pressure when going through the valve
